Installing addIT RTUs in the field is a fairly simple process. You'll
perform a connectivity check with an LED tool (addIT devices don't
have a built-in LED like the A730MD stations do).
Note: The LED tool is a blind plug to be plugged in the
connector.
Follow these steps to install an addIT RTU in the field:
1.
Review the installation area and choose the best site.
2.
Perform a connectivity check using the LED tool:
a.
Insert the LED tool in the
10 seconds. If the unit connects to at least one station (or
a base station), it will light up the LED for about 4
seconds.
b.
Keep observing the LED tool and, after another several
seconds, the LED will blink one or more times (the
number of blinks indicates the number of stations it has
contacted).
